Buhari Replies PDP: I Have Cold, Not Cancer by gift01: 6:54pm On Jan 19, 2015
PRESIDENTIAL candidate of the All Progressives Congress (APC) in the February election, Major-General Muhammadu Buhari, on Sunday, cleared the air on his health status, saying he only had cold and not cancer as rumoured.

Speculations were rife on Sunday that the APC presidential standard-bearer was diagnosed of terminal disease, with a newspaper stating that he had been flown abroad.

But addressing newsmen at the Rivers State Governor’s Lodge, Asokoro, Abuja, on Sunday, Buhari said “I don’t know the reason for this desperation. The issue we are telling Nigerians is that of corruption in this country. What has my health got to do with that?

“Have I been sick on a daily basis? And (that) document has been put on paper, on Tweeter that I am sick. The Ahmadu Bello University Teaching Hospital (ABUTH) said they are forged documents. This desperation is beyond my understanding.”

He tasked politicians to forget issues about his health status, but rather discuss issues about the welfare and well-being of Nigerians.

“Vanguard reported that I was to jet out for medical check-up yesterday, but here am I. I was at Nasarawa and Benue states yesterday, tomorrow, I am going to be in two states.

“Day after tomorrow, I’ll be in two more states. I am doing two states per day. How they got the impression that I was sick I do not know, although I got cold, but that did not stop me from going through my schedule”, he maintained.

When pressed to make a categorical statement on his state of health, Buhari, in a joking manner, asked: “how old are you, 50 years? I am telling you, if we go to the field, you would not last the time I will last in the field.”

The APC presidential candidate also declared himself free of corruption charges, saying “that one has been cleared. There is no fraud in PTF. There was an investigation and General Obasanjo has answered that question. He confirmed that there was an investigation and the report was brought to him and there was nothing on ground as far as my management and chairmanship of the PTF was concerned.

According to Buhari, “the person who did the investigation, because he was the head of state, cleared me, so what else can I say?”

On his certificate, he said that “why didn’t Nigerians ask? I have contested three times under the same rules set by Independent National Electoral Commission (INEC). I was allowed to contest all these elections because my certificate was in order. There were individuals that wrote to the United States War College and the college answered them, it was published by some of your papers.

“Really, this misinformation will do nobody any good, because our minds are being taken away from the serious issues of corruption and incompetence by the PDP.”
